I decided to go with the altoid "Office in a Box" idea seen here on SCS (Thanks for the idea!) I found the mini calculator at Staples for .99, little gel pen was found in party-supplies at Walmart, the little notepad was cut a bit smaller to fit one of those great clipboards (which I also trimmed and sanded to fit). I put magnets on the back of the clipboard to keep it in place. Then I thought little clips and paper clips would be perfect - it all fits inside and closes nicely!
